mirror of
https://github.com/clangen/musikcube.git
synced 2024-11-19 11:10:52 +00:00
Enable ccache for builds if installed.
This commit is contained in:
parent
3adc1fb28f
commit
6e06b70fea
@ -28,6 +28,13 @@ include(ConfigureTaglib)
|
||||
include(ConfigureCompilerFlags)
|
||||
include(FindVendorLibrary)
|
||||
|
||||
find_program(CCACHE_FOUND ccache)
|
||||
if (CCACHE_FOUND)
|
||||
message(STATUS "${BoldGreen}[ccache] ccache enabled!${ColorReset}")
|
||||
set_property(GLOBAL PROPERTY RULE_LAUNCH_COMPILE ccache)
|
||||
set_property(GLOBAL PROPERTY RULE_LAUNCH_LINK ccache)
|
||||
endif(CCACHE_FOUND)
|
||||
|
||||
if (CROSS_COMPILE_SYSROOT)
|
||||
message(STATUS "[cross-compile] enabled, rooted at: ${CROSS_COMPILE_SYSROOT}")
|
||||
set(CMAKE_FIND_ROOT_PATH ${CROSS_COMPILE_SYSROOT} ${musikcube_SOURCE_DIR}/vendor)
|
||||
|
Loading…
Reference in New Issue
Block a user